1 Injured in Oroville Pedestrian Accident

 
OROVILLE, CA (February 10, 2020) – A vehicle struck and injured a man on Veatch Street in Oroville on February 7.
 
At about 11:44 a.m., a man started to cross Veatch Street at Mitchell Avenue. He then got hit by a northbound Ford Focus, Officer Breck Wright of the Oroville Police Department revealed.
 
Responders took the man to the Oroville Hospital with non-life-threatening injuries.
 
Wright added that when paramedics arrived, they extricated the pedestrian from the hood of the car.
 
The crash remains under investigation, and the police did not arrest anyone. Authorities also ruled out drugs or alcohol as a factor in the collision.
 
“We never want a collision, but we also don’t ever want people driving under the influence,” Wright added.
